Lightning kills 5 workers

Sun News Desk: Five brickfield workers lost their lives and one more injured due to lightning in Rangpur's Pirganj on Tuesday afternoon.

The deceased are- Nazmul, 18, son of Badsha Mia of Thaperhat Tilakpara village of Sadulyapur, Siam, 20, son of Sirul of Chakandi village of Idilpur union of the same upazila, Shahadat, 25, son of Al Amin, Rashedul, 24, son of Aytal And Jabbar, son of Abdul Jalil of Chaksholagari village in Pirganj.

The injured Mehedul is a resident of Rasulpur village in Kabilpur union of Pirganj upazila.

Abdul Awal, Officer-in-Charge (OC) of Pirganj Police Station, said that police have been sent to the spot.

Rabiul Islam, Chairman of Kabilpur Union, said that all the victims were workers. They worked in a brickfield at Chaksholagari in Pirganj upazila, 32 miles east of Dhaperhat. He also said that the lightning incident happened suddenly in the rain.
